Describe a place you went to and an outdoor activity you did there: IELTS Speaking Cue Card

You should say

  • Where the place is
  • What outdoor activity you did
  • When/with whom you went
  • And explain why you enjoyed it

Cue 1:Where the place is

  • Begin by naming the place and providing a brief description of its location.
  • Mention any notable features of the place that make it special.

Example

I visited a beautiful hill station called Munnar, located in the Western Ghats of Kerala. It is famous for its lush green tea plantations and stunning landscapes.


Cue 2:What outdoor activity you did

  • Describe the specific outdoor activity you engaged in and what it involved.
  • Share any interesting details about the activity that made it enjoyable.

Example

During my visit, I went trekking through the tea gardens. The trek was invigorating, and I loved walking amidst the fragrant tea bushes while enjoying the fresh mountain air.


Cue 3:When/with whom you went

  • Mention when you visited the place, including the season or time of year.
  • Talk about who you went with and your relationship with them.

Example

I went to Munnar last summer with my college friends. We had planned this trip for months, and it was a great way to reconnect after our exams.


Cue 4:And explain why you enjoyed it

  • Reflect on your feelings during the experience and what made it memorable.
  • Highlight any personal connections or lessons learned from the activity.

Example

I enjoyed the trek immensely because it allowed me to bond with my friends while appreciating nature's beauty. The sense of achievement after reaching the top of the hill was exhilarating, and it reminded me of the importance of adventure in life.


Conclusion

    Example

    Overall, my trip to Munnar and the trekking experience was not only fun but also refreshing. It helped me unwind and create lasting memories with my friends, making it one of my favorite outdoor adventures.


    Following this structure will ensure you cover all the essential points while providing a clear and engaging response to the cue card topic.


    Tips to answer this Cue Card

    1: Lack of Specific Details

    Avoid vague descriptions of the place or activity. Specific details help paint a clearer picture for the examiner and make your response more engaging.

    bulb icon

    Tip

    Include specific names, locations, and descriptions of the activity to create a vivid image in the listener's mind.


    2: Ignoring the Cues

    Failing to address all the cues can lead to an incomplete answer. This may result in a lower score for coherence and relevance.

    bulb icon

    Tip

    Make sure to cover each cue in your response, ensuring a structured and comprehensive answer.


    Overly Simple Language

    Using overly simple language can make your response sound unprepared. It may not showcase your full range of vocabulary and grammar skills.

    bulb icon

    Tip

    Incorporate a variety of vocabulary and sentence structures to demonstrate your language proficiency while keeping it clear.
